A Research and Development Manager with extensive experience in innovation, research, development, technology transfer and intellectual property protection in both the public and private sector.

Experience in optics, µ-optics, optical fibres and optical nstrumentation including

• optical fibre coupler development

• distance measurement using astigmatic confocal microscopy

• fibre-optic confocal microscopy (led to formation of two Melbourne based companies)

• optic/fibre optic/image analysis based wool fibre diameter measurement (determines all of Australia's and much of the rest of the world's wool fibre diameter prior to sale)

• µ-optic components for optical fibre telecommunications.

James Hardie - Durability Research Manager (1995-2000). Led durability team - durability is James Hardie's competitive advantage . Participated in a range of cross-functional fibre cement product developments . Negotiation and collaboration with businesses, universities and statutory bodies in Aust., NZ, Japan and USA.
• CSIRO - Principal Research Scientist (1986-1995)- Laserscan wool fibre diameter measurement - Invention, R&D, tech. transfer and IP protection. Assisted with standards, worldwide introduction and customer feedback. More than 120 instruments sold ($12M) but real value is implementation of dependable, commercially attractive, objective measurement system for pricing Australian wool
Fibre optic confocal microscope ideas and development, which resulted in formation of Optiscan Pty Ltd and HBH Technological Industries
Led development of astigmatic confocal microscope industrial distance measurement system
